After treatment, a fibre-rich diet, adequate fluids, and foods that support soft stools are generally helpful. Dr. Shagun Rao can provide diet and recovery guidance suited to your procedure.
Temporary discomfort, swelling, minor bleeding, or changes in bowel habits may occur after treatment. Risks vary by procedure and patient. Dr. Shagun Rao can explain the expected recovery before treatment.
Recurrence is possible after any piles treatment because new hemorrhoids can develop. Following bowel and lifestyle advice can help reduce risk. Dr. Shagun Rao can discuss long-term prevention.
